I don’t link to purely political things here all that often, but the justification of America’s drone-strike policy offered by TIME columnist Joe Klein discussed in this post is so soul-deadeningly horrifying, and thus so relevant to matters of war as presented in A Song of Ice and Fire, that I thought it bore special mention:

    KLEIN: “I completely disagree with you… . It has been remarkably successful” —

    SCARBOROUGH: “at killing people” —

    KLEIN: “At decimating bad people, taking out a lot of bad people - and saving Americans lives as well, because our troops don’t have to do this … You don’t need pilots any more because you do it with a joystick in California.”

    SCARBOROUGH: “This is offensive to me, though. Because you do it with a joystick in California - and it seems so antiseptic - it seems so clean - and yet you have 4-year-old girls being blown to bits because we have a policy that now says: “you know what? Instead of trying to go in and take the risk and get the terrorists out of hiding in a Karachi suburb, we’re just going to blow up everyone around them.

    “This is what bothers me… . We don’t detain people any more: we kill them, and we kill everyone around them… . I hate to sound like a Code Pink guy here. I’m telling you this quote ‘collateral damage’ - it seems so clean with a joystick from California - this is going to cause the US problems in the future.”

    KLEIN: “If it is misused, and there is a really major possibility of abuse if you have the wrong people running the government. But: the bottom line in the end is - whose 4-year-old get killed? What we’re doing is limiting the possibility that 4-year-olds here will get killed by indiscriminate acts of terror.”

    Tribalism at its most repellent; a willful rejection of empathy for other human beings, even children, with cruelty so casual it’s astonishing to behold. Sound familiar?
